Output 95cadc277925539bb666170a3edcc22b78a62980376a889623875b2a804cbfe9:25

value
119456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5be4778fbdf58df3a831f37901d65fb8339f88c2 OP_EQUAL
address
3A4u7AiayvSQD8nHUXx2fMesctEAALa3ga
transaction
95cadc277925539bb666170a3edcc22b78a62980376a889623875b2a804cbfe9
confirmations
291771
spent
true